Quercetin, a bioactive plant flavonoid, is an antioxidant, and as such it exhibits numerous beneficial properties including anti-inflammatory, antiallergic, antibacterial antiviral activity. It occurs naturally in fruit vegetables apples, blueberries, cranberries, lettuce, present waste onion peel or grape pomace which constitute good sources of quercetin for technological pharmaceutical purposes. The presented study focuses on the role prevention treatment dermatological diseases analyzing its effect at molecular level, signal transduction metabolism. Presented aspects potential skin include protection against aging UV radiation, stimulation wound healing, reduction melanogenesis, oxidation. article discusses (plant products included), methods medical administration, perspectives further use dermatology diet therapy.
